]> git.meshlink.io Git - catta/blob - avahi-daemon/Server.introspect
* fix Server introspection data
[catta] / avahi-daemon / Server.introspect
1 <?xml version="1.0" standalone='no'?><!--*-nxml-*-->
2 <!DOCTYPE node SYSTEM "introspect.dtd">
3 <node>
4
5   <!-- $Id$ -->
6
7  <interface name="org.freedesktop.DBus.Introspectable">
8     <method name="Introspect">
9       <arg name="data" direction="out" type="s"/>
10     </method>
11   </interface>
12
13   <interface name="org.freedesktop.Avahi.Server">
14     <method name="GetVersionString">
15       <arg name="version" type="s" direction="out"/>
16     </method>
17
18     <method name="GetHostName">
19       <arg name="name" type="s" direction="out"/>
20     </method>
21     <method name="GetHostNameFqdn">
22       <arg name="name" type="s" direction="out"/>
23     </method>
24     <method name="GetDomainName">
25       <arg name="name" type="s" direction="out"/>
26     </method>
27
28     <method name="GetState">
29       <arg name="state" type="i" direction="out"/>
30     </method>
31     <signal name="StateChanged">
32       <arg name="state" type="i"/>
33     </signal>
34
35     <method name="GetAlternativeHostName">
36       <arg name="name" type="s" direction="in"/>
37       <arg name="name" type="s" direction="out"/>
38     </method>
39
40     <method name="GetAlternativeServiceName">
41       <arg name="name" type="s" direction="in"/>
42       <arg name="name" type="s" direction="out"/>
43     </method>
44
45     <method name="ResolveHostName">
46       <arg name="interface" type="i" direction="in"/>
47       <arg name="protocol" type="i" direction="in"/>
48       <arg name="name" type="s" direction="in"/>
49       <arg name="aprotocol" type="i" direction="in"/>
50
51       <arg name="interface" type="i" direction="out"/>
52       <arg name="protocol" type="i" direction="out"/>
53       <arg name="name" type="s" direction="out"/>
54       <arg name="aprotocol" type="i" direction="out"/>
55       <arg name="address" type="s" direction="out"/>
56     </method>
57
58     <method name="ResolveAddress">
59       <arg name="interface" type="i" direction="in"/>
60       <arg name="protocol" type="i" direction="in"/>
61       <arg name="address" type="s" direction="in"/>
62
63       <arg name="interface" type="i" direction="out"/>
64       <arg name="protocol" type="i" direction="out"/>
65       <arg name="aprotocol" type="i" direction="out"/>
66       <arg name="address" type="s" direction="out"/>
67       <arg name="name" type="s" direction="out"/>
68     </method>
69
70     <method name="ResolveService">
71       <arg name="interface" type="i" direction="in"/>
72       <arg name="protocol" type="i" direction="in"/>
73       <arg name="name" type="s" direction="in"/>
74       <arg name="type" type="s" direction="in"/>
75       <arg name="domain" type="s" direction="in"/>
76       <arg name="aprotocol" type="i" direction="in"/>
77
78       <arg name="interface" type="i" direction="out"/>
79       <arg name="protocol" type="i" direction="out"/>
80       <arg name="name" type="s" direction="out"/>
81       <arg name="type" type="s" direction="out"/>
82       <arg name="domain" type="s" direction="out"/>
83       <arg name="host" type="s" direction="out"/>
84       <arg name="aprotocol" type="i" direction="out"/>
85       <arg name="address" type="s" direction="out"/>
86       <arg name="port" type="q" direction="out"/>
87       <arg name="txt" type="as" direction="out"/>
88     </method>
89
90     <method name="EntryGroupNew">
91       <arg name="path" type="o" direction="out"/>
92     </method>
93
94     <method name="DomainBrowserNew">
95       <arg name="interface" type="i" direction="in"/>
96       <arg name="protocol" type="i" direction="in"/>
97       <arg name="domain" type="s" direction="in"/>
98       <arg name="btype" type="i" direction="in"/>
99
100       <arg name="path" type="o" direction="out"/>
101     </method>
102
103     <method name="ServiceTypeBrowserNew">
104       <arg name="interface" type="i" direction="in"/>
105       <arg name="protocol" type="i" direction="in"/>
106       <arg name="domain" type="s" direction="in"/>
107
108       <arg name="path" type="o" direction="out"/>
109     </method>
110
111     <method name="ServiceBrowserNew">
112       <arg name="interface" type="i" direction="in"/>
113       <arg name="protocol" type="i" direction="in"/>
114       <arg name="type" type="s" direction="in"/>
115       <arg name="domain" type="s" direction="in"/>
116
117       <arg name="path" type="o" direction="out"/>
118     </method>
119
120   </interface>
121
122 </node>